  • The EU Omnibus Package | Why Sustainability Still Matters
    Mar 18 2025

    In this episode, TDi's CEO Assheton Stewart Carter talks to international negotiator Peter Handley and TDi's Jeannette Greven about the omnibus package of regulatory amendments recently published by the EU Commission. The talking points include:

    • Why the changes proposed in the omnibus package are being made
    • What this means for businesses of different sizes and what companies both in scope and out of scope should do next to identify and manage supply chain risk
    • Whether the omnibus package marks the end of the Brussels Effect and what it means for the European Green Deal as a whole
    • What this means in the context of EU/US relations and for the EU regulatory landscape as a whole
    • Why sustainability should still be a priority for businesses when it comes to ensuring long-term resilience

    Peter Handley is a policy shaper and international negotiator with experience in energy and climate, circular economy and international trade negotiations. Peter worked for the European Commission for more than 20 years, where he was head of the unit for energy intensive industries and raw materials. Peter is also Special Advisor to the Global Council for Responsible Transition Minerals – a Paris Peace Forum initiative. Peter recently founded PHASE32, an independent consultancy working on sustainability and resilience.

    Jeannette Greven is a Senior Sustainability Consultant at TDi, with a background in international development and qualitative research in conflict-affected areas. Jeannette works on projects that range from developing responsible sourcing strategies, to engagement with artisanal mining communities.

  • The EU Conflict Minerals Regulation | Findings from the first review
    Mar 13 2025

    Jeanette Greven, Senior Sustainability Consultant at TDi, joins Sarah Wilkinson, TDi's Marketing Manager to discuss TDi’s contribution to, and findings from, the first review of the EU Conflict Minerals Regulation (CMR), which was adopted in September 2024.

    The review was led by the TDi Sustainability team, and Sarah and Jeannette discuss the review methodology, the shortcomings identified by the team and some recommendations for how these could be addressed. Jeannette also examines practical steps that companies can take to ensure that they're complying with the Conflict Minerals Regulation, and looks at how the CMR fits in with other key EU Regulations, touching on recent changes introduced by the omnibus package.

  • Giving a voice to future generations | Mining Indaba Insights 2025
    Jan 30 2025

    In this episode, TDi's CEO Assheton Carter, talks to two representatives from different parts of the mining industry, who will all be speaking at the 2025 Mining Indaba in Cape Town, on giving a voice to future generations, including specific emphasis on women in mining.

    The panelists are:
    Zenzi Awases | President, Association of Women in Mining in Africa
    Linda Omara Koledade | Mining and Metals Dealmaker, Start-up Mentor, Founder - IDC, Savant, Mustard Seed

    The speakers discuss how the next generation of miners can be better integrated into an evolving mining industry, and how new approaches and opinions can be embraced to help build a stronger and more resilient mining sector in Africa. They discuss the specific role of women in mining and gender equality in the mining industry.
